About the Artist: Andrea Bocelli
Andrea Bocelli is an Italian tenor whose career spans classical crossover, operatic performance, and popular music. His distinctive voice and ability to communicate emotional depth have made him one of the most commercially successful classical artists in the world, with recordings that reach audiences far beyond traditional concert halls.
Bocelli's involvement with film scores and holiday projects demonstrates his range as an interpreter. His participation in Disney's "A Christmas Carol" brought his signature warmth to material designed for broad audiences, making him an ideal artist for arrangements that bridge classical and popular sensibilities.
Why we love this
Joseph M. Martin's arrangement captures the emotional core of this Disney theme without overshadowing young singers. The multiple voicing options give you flexibility to cast singers at different levels, and the orchestration feels substantial without being overwhelming for a youth ensemble.
What to expect
The piece radiates sincerity and warmth without saccharine sweetness. There's a gentle nobility to the melodic writing that invites singers to find their own emotional investment in the text, creating moments of genuine reflection within a festive context.
Who it's for
Youth choirs and community ensembles looking for repertoire that connects to familiar, beloved film music. This works equally well for singers who enjoy singing Sacred repertoire and those primarily drawn to contemporary popular songs.
How to get the most out of it
- Balance the text with sustained legato phrasing; the message of kindness deserves unhurried delivery rather than rhythmic tension
- Let the orchestral accompaniment breathe during instrumental interludes instead of using those moments to reset or reset posture
- Shape phrases toward the text accents rather than metric downbeats, which creates a conversational quality appropriate to the message
How to use it
Place this as an anchor to your Christmas concert or as a standalone holiday concert finale. It provides a moment of reflection and uplift that audiences expect from holiday programming while remaining accessible for younger singers.
Skills your students will build
- Sustaining legit vocal tone across descending phrases
- Balancing ensemble blend when reading from orchestral accompaniment
- Communicating text meaning through phrase shaping
- Managing dynamic control in a cappella sections
